A Sanctuary of the Apocalyptic: The Coastal Comfort Station Let me start by saying, if you're looking for a pristine, scented, and climate-controlled lavatory experience... keep walking. For about four miles. Because that's how far you'll have to walk to escape the inevitable need for this glorious, terrifying, five-star lavatory experience. This isn't just a public convenience; it's a post-apocalyptic survival experience. The abandoned buildings it resides in give the perfect, brooding atmosphere for a quick pit stop before your next zombie encounter (or just an invigorating coastal walk). Highlights of the Experience: • Atmosphere: A chillingly authentic "end-of-days" vibe. The lack of heating simply adds to the rugged, pioneer feel. Who needs central heating when you have the cold embrace of the coastal wind rushing through your legs? 10/10 for realism. • Wildlife Integration: Forget boring tiles—this toilet comes with a built-in ecosystem! I was lucky enough to share my moment of reflection with a few brave spiders and what appeared to be a whole family of nesting birds. It’s truly a biodiversity hotspot. • Natures gifts: Forget air fresheners; the complimentary bird droppings on the toilet paper are a unique, earthy touch. It's a reminder that we are all just a small part of the great cycle of nature. (Pro tip: use the inner layers.) • The adrenaline rush hand wash: Ah, the hot water unit. Turning it on is the first true test of your hike: a brief, heart-stopping moment of courage, testing your resolve against the genuine, palpable threat of electric shock. If you survive, you're rewarded with a small trickle of water, proving the system works! An adrenaline rush you simply won't find in a regular public loo. The Verdict Why the five stars? Because when you're four miles out on a beautiful, yet desolate, spit of land, having held it in since the last signs of human inhabitation, this dilapidated, spider-infested, bird-inhabited shell of a building isn't just a toilet—it's a miracle. It's a gritty, glorious, life-saving reminder that any port in a storm (or any bowl in a bladder emergency) is heaven. Come for the nature, stay because you literally have no other option. Highly, highly recommended for the adventurous and desperate.
